- The latest Amiga Shopper has an advert on the inside back cover from First
- Computers Leeds with the Surfer Pack on sale at 559.99 UK pounds. This suggests
- an RRP of 599.99 UK pounds.
-
- The Q-Drive is advertised at 239.99 UK pounds.
-
- While the Q-Drive might be just about acceptable to some people, I feel that
- the surfer pack is way overpriced once more (though to a lesser degree than the
- standard Magic A1200. Under 500 UK pounds RRP and I might have considered it.
-
- What`s worse is that, unless Scala is not included in the Surfer pack, the
- Amiga A1200HD Magic pack is only 100 UK pounds cheaper and not worth buying if
- you were interested in an A1200. :(
